]> Creatis software - cpPlugins.git/blobdiff - lib/cpPipelineEditor/Block.h
Windows compilation is broken.
[cpPlugins.git] / lib / cpPipelineEditor / Block.h
index bbdb0c61038a37d4c6c43576b8ffd801d0cefb78..6ee84f662a91c49ac0cab0794b8d3c34e9d360e3 100644 (file)
@@ -3,7 +3,7 @@
 \r
 #include <cpPipelineEditor/cpPipelineEditor_Export.h>\r
 #include <QGraphicsPathItem>\r
-#include <cpPlugins/Interface/ProcessObject.h>\r
+#include <cpPlugins/ProcessObject.h>\r
 \r
 namespace cpPipelineEditor\r
 {\r
@@ -19,19 +19,22 @@ namespace cpPipelineEditor
     : public QGraphicsPathItem\r
   {\r
   public:\r
-    typedef Block             Self;\r
-    typedef QGraphicsPathItem Superclass;\r
-    typedef cpPlugins::Interface::ProcessObject TFilter;\r
+    typedef Block                    Self;\r
+    typedef QGraphicsPathItem        Superclass;\r
+    typedef cpPlugins::ProcessObject TFilter;\r
   \r
   public:\r
     enum { Type = QGraphicsItem::UserType + 6 };\r
 \r
     Block(\r
-      TFilter* filter,\r
+      TFilter* filter, const QString& name,\r
       QGraphicsItem* parent = NULL, QGraphicsScene* scene = NULL\r
       );\r
     virtual ~Block( );\r
 \r
+    TFilter* filter( );\r
+    const TFilter* filter( ) const;\r
+\r
     Editor* editor( );\r
     const Editor* editor( ) const;\r
     void setEditor( Editor* editor );\r